(Alan Berner / The Seattle Times)  More  Skip Ad   By  Lewis Kamb   Seattle Times staff reporter Recent sampling at Washington’s only forensic toxicology laboratory has found more areas contaminated with methamphetamine and cocaine, raising further skepticism among defense lawyers about the integrity of blood testing being performed at a lab relied upon in thousands of criminal cases and death investigations statewide.
